Hawk 40th Anniversary

On the 21st August 1974 the first Hawk T Mk1, XX154, flew for the first time from Dunsfold in the capable hands of Duncan Simpson. Therefore, today is the 40th anniversary of that notable event.

XX154 is still flying from Boscombe Down, mainly used by ETPS for training test pilots and Flight Test Engineers. As of today it has flown 5516 hours, and it did fly today from Boscombe and I believe it was seen in the skies over both Dunsfold and RAF Valley.

The RAF took delivery of the first aircraft in November 1976 and the first course to fly the Hawk at 4 FTS, RAF Valley, commenced in July 1977. That is an interesting timescale when compared to some later procurement programmes.
